更新时间:2024-10-14 GMT+08:00

手动切换主备实例

操作场景

云数据库RDS主备类型的实例创建成功后,系统会在同一区域内为该实例创建一个备实例。主备实例的数据会实时同步,用户仅能访问主实例数据,备实例仅作为备份形式存在。您可根据业务需要,进行主备实例的切换,切换后原来的主实例会变成备实例,可实现机架级别的容灾。

注意事项

对于主备切换、主备实例规格变更、小版本升级等涉及到主备切换的场景:

如果在主备倒换发生时,业务中慢SQL仍未执行完成,可能会导致该慢SQL连接卡住(新建连接及其余空闲连接不受影响),并在一段时间后客户端返回报错。返回报错时间与客户端keepalives_idle、keepalives_interval、keepalives_count等tcp参数配置有关,具体参数查看官方文档

约束限制

同时满足以下条件,才能手动切换主备实例。

  • 实例运行正常。
  • 主备“复制状态”为“正常”。
  • 主备复制时延小于5分钟且主备数据一致。

操作步骤

  1. 登录管理控制台
  2. 单击管理控制台左上角的,选择区域。
  3. 单击页面左上角的,选择“数据库 > 云数据库 RDS”,进入RDS信息页面。
  4. “实例管理”页面,选择指定的主备实例,单击实例名称,进入实例的“概览”页面。
  5. 在“概览”页面的“实例类型”处,单击“主备切换”

    主备切换可能会造成几秒或几分钟的服务闪断(闪断时间与复制时延有关),根据经验,当事务日志生成速率超30 MB/s时,服务中断时间可能会达到分钟级。请在业务低峰期进行主备切换,避免对高峰期业务造成影响。

  6. 若您已开启高危操作保护,在“身份验证”弹出框中单击“获取验证码”,正确输入验证码并单击“确定”,页面自动关闭。

    通过进行二次认证再次确认您的身份,进一步提高账号安全性,有效保护您安全使用云产品。关于如何开启操作保护,具体请参考《统一身份认证服务用户指南》的内容。

  7. “主备切换”弹框,单击“确定”进行主备实例的切换。
  8. 主备切换成功后,用户可以在“实例管理”页面对其进行查看和管理。

    • 切换过程中,状态显示为“主备切换中”。
    • 在实例列表的右上角,单击刷新列表,可查看到主备切换完成后,实例状态显示为“正常”